740LD Experience

Guys, i have been given a 740LD for several weeks as a complimentary car whilst my new vehicle is being built, some of you may have read about the issues i have had with BMW. I thought id share my experience given that i have never driven or lived with a 7 series before.

In a word its FANTASTIC, different driving experience to all other BMWs in that its quite floaty but at the same time never loose or saggy under hard breaking or cornering, ride quality is superb. Spec wise fully loaded with all the driver aids, rear entertainment pack, massage seats, blinds,etc etc. The 3.0d engine is the same as in my previous 640d and many other 6 pot diesels id guess, though tuned for better low down / more torque and this shows, id suggest that its the quickest diesel that BMW produce. So what more can i say other than if i was a few years older i would gladly have one of these over and Audi A8 or S Class, anyone in the market will not have an issue in owning the new 7, Oh and the xdrive makes all the difference too by enabling all that power to be used.

So to conclude not missing my m6 and have no issue in waiting for my new M6 GC to turn up, anyone in the market should give this a serious look its a superb piece of engineering.

Thanks for sharing your experience , I had test driven a G11 730 gasoline too. It was not the quickest the car I had ever driven but somehow managed to leave a good feedback on me .The ride wasn't sublime though it might be due to 19" RFT Pirelli tires and bad road surface other than that in Comfort Mode the car was very solid and comfortable . All in all, that's a 7 Series and I think Mercedes-Benz will be feeling more heat coming from behind as long as BMW makes 7 Series that good

not sure if the long wheel has a different suspension set up, what i can conclude is that the ride is very good, S class smooth id say and the 740d engine is the best diesel set up i have driven.

I cant bore of the way car floats and pushes you forwards at the same time.

I recall this feeling many many years ago as riding in the back of late 1970s Merc S Class 6.9ltr, i must have been 7 at the time.
